大数据与 Java276


大数据是指海量且复杂的数据集,其大小和复杂性超出了传统数据处理工具的处理能力。处理大数据需要特殊技术和工具,而 Java 在这一领域发挥着重要作用。

Java 的优势
平台无关性:Java 遵循 "一次编写,随处运行" 的原则,使其代码可以在不同的平台上运行,包括 Linux、Windows 和 macOS。
可扩展性:Java 具有高度可扩展性,支持处理和分析海量数据集。
并行处理:Java 支持多线程和并行处理,允许在大数据集上同时执行多个任务,从而提高处理速度。
丰富的库:Java 提供了广泛的库,例如 Apache Hadoop、Apache Spark 和 Apache Flink,专门用于大数据处理。

Java 在大数据中的应用

Java 在大数据领域有着广泛的应用,包括:
数据收集和存储:Java 可用于从各种来源收集数据,并将它们存储在分布式文件系统(如 HDFS)中。
数据处理:Java 可用于处理大数据集,执行数据清洗、转换和分析任务。
分布式计算:Java 支持使用框架(例如 Hadoop MapReduce)进行分布式计算,以并行处理大型数据集。
机器学习:Java 可用于开发机器学习算法,将数据转换为可操作的洞察。
大数据可视化:Java 可用于创建交互式仪表盘和可视化工具,以便轻松探索和分析大数据集。

结论

虽然 Java 本身并不是一种大数据技术,但它提供了强大的工具和库,使开发人员能够有效地处理和分析大数据集。Java 的平台无关性、可扩展性、并行处理和丰富的库使其成为大数据领域的理想选择。

2024-10-28


上一篇:**Java 数据库登录:分步指南**

下一篇:Java 中使用 JDBC 访问数据库